Webhook delivery in Pushlark retries with exponential backoff: 1s, 4s, 16s, then hourly for 24 hours. Retries are idempotent only if the receiver honors our delivery ID header, so never reorder the queue manually. Failed batches land in the graveyard topic for replay. The signing secret used to HMAC each payload goes on the next line.

vault entry, kahip-fahog: RELAY_SECRET20=6a2c791de808f35c3b55

TICKET WK-883 — Viewer role can edit restricted wiki pages
Severity: Critical. Needs security review before hotfix.

Repro:
1. On Pagemarsh staging, create a space with edit restricted to Maintainers.
2. Log in as user with Viewer role only.
3. Open any restricted page, append `?mode=edit` to the URL.
4. Editor loads; saves persist.

Expected: 403 on edit attempt.
Actual: role check skipped on the edit route.

Reviewer can reproduce against the staging API using the bearer token below.

session JWT of yawep-yawep = eyJhbGciOiJIUzI1NiIsInR5cCI6IkpXVCJ9.eyJzdWIiOiI3pWF3_In0.aXYsHiog

Handover note — Tideline widget (from Maren to Okke)

Okke, taking over Tideline maintenance from me as of Friday. Main thing plugin authors hit: the prediction cache refreshes hourly, but the harmonic-constants feed only updates nightly, so interpolation gaps show up around midnight. There's a workaround flag, documented in the plugin guide. Plugins should never assume the default station list. Everything else is stable. For reference, here is the current production configuration.

deployment values, kajep-kageg:
[praix]
host = praix.paliqcorp.corp
user = praix_svc
database = praix_prod